> On 09/13/2010 07:49 AM, Bryan Wu wrote:
>> From: Gary King <gking at nvidia.com>
>>
>> the bounced page needs to be flushed after data is copied into it,
>> to ensure that architecture implementations can synchronize
>> instruction and data caches if necessary.
>>
>> This patch was posted at armlinux mail list and was asked by Andrew
>> Morton and Jens Axboe. We tried this patch and found is fixed memtester
>> issue.

>> diff --git a/mm/bounce.c b/mm/bounce.c
>> index 13b6dad..1481de6 100644
>> --- a/mm/bounce.c
>> +++ b/mm/bounce.c
>> @@ -116,8 +116,8 @@ static void copy_to_high_bio_irq(struct bio *to, struct bio *from)
>>                */
>>               vfrom = page_address(fromvec->bv_page) + tovec->bv_offset;
>>
>> -             flush_dcache_page(tovec->bv_page);
>>               bounce_copy_vec(tovec, vfrom);
>> +             flush_dcache_page(tovec->bv_page);
>>       }
>>  }
